Seattle’s own Elizabeth C. D. Brown will give a live-streamed solo program titled “Music of Light and Life.” After opening with music by Heitor Villa-Lobos, the performance will feature works by 3 living composers: Thomas Flippin, Kevin Callahan, and Olga Amelkina-Vera. This inspiring music celebrates themes like new life, growing up, light overcoming darkness and the triumph of the human spirit in a special tribute to Heath Care workers. Some of the composers will make virtual appearances to briefly discuss their music during the live-stream.

Elizabeth Brown is head of the Guitar and Lute program at Pacific Lutheran University and is active throughout the Pacific Northwest as a solo and ensemble performer. Known for her musically passionate performances, she has given solo recitals and performed concertos throughout North America. Ms. Brown's first solo recording, La Folía de España: Dances for Guitar, features works for baroque, 19th-century and modern guitars. "Her personal involvement with the music is very apparent: this woman enjoys her music and her audience can't help but be swept along with her" – Guitar Soundings (Seattle).
